Cisco Account Development Specialist (Remote) in San Francisco, California

At Cisco Meraki, we know that technology can connect, empower, and drive us. By simplifying powerful technology, we can free passionate people to focus on their mission. As the fastest-growing cloud-managed team in the world, our product and technology architecture are changing the landscape of enterprise networking and making cloud-managed IT a reality.

The Product team of a leading Cisco solution (Cisco Spaces) is looking for an Account Development Specialist with experience in customer outreach, mapping solutions with customer needs, and product adoption!

What You'll Do:

  • Become an expert in discovery, use case specific infrastructure requirements, & full stack Cisco Spaces value

  • Understand Ideal customer profile & personas, and have the ability to overcome objections, listen, and ask critical questions to resolve customer needs

  • Focus on daily and weekly direct customer engagements via various sources: recently activated, inbound requests, health report, and existing customer adoption requests

  • Setup and drive calls with customers across different geographies and industries to drive use case awareness, adoption, and encourage them to try new features

  • Schedule and run product demos to internal and external partners to promote product adoption and ideal customer journey.

  • Ensure timely engagement with customers

  • Stay abreast on deployment process, technical requirements, use cases, product improvements, and product roadmaps in order to have effective communication with customers, Account Managers and Partners

  • Liaise with accounts teams, partner resellers & product sales specialists to ensure customer needs are met.

Who You'll Work With:

  • You will be working with the Meraki Product Management team. This group owns Cisco Spaces, the world’s most powerful location cloud platform that has already digitized over 9.5 billion sq. ft. of enterprise airspace - and we are just getting started. Who You Are:

  • You’re an expert at interacting with customers in a remote / virtual environment.

  • You have an ability to collaborate with ease across various internal and external teams

  • You’re skilled at objection handling and meeting customer expectations

  • You deliver product demos with sophisticated messaging in a confident and convincing manner.

  • You are a team player, self-starter, and results oriented.

Skills:

  • Effective communication, persuasion, and objection handling skills

  • Strong discernment with critical thinking

  • Excellent analytical, time management, organizational & troubleshooting skills

  • Ability to handle a high volume of appointments, and stay organized

Experience & Education:

  • 2-4 years of experience in sales development/customer success/interfacing/engagement role

  • Strong communication skills

  • Saas Experience Preferred

  • Any Bachelor's degree

  • CCNA certification preferred
